Abstract
New electroluminescent materials, two DCM analogues 1,4-Bis[2-[3-(1,1-dicyan ovinyl)-5,5-dimethyl-cyclohexeneyl]vinyl]benzene (1) and 1,4-Bis{2-[3-(1,1-dicya novinyl)-5,5-dimethyl-cyclohexeneyl]vinyl}-2,5-di-(n-butoxy)benzene (2) with A-π-D-π-A structure were synthesized and characterized. Optical properties (UV–vis and fluorescence) were studied for both compounds according to the spectra analysis. Theoretical calculation and cyclic voltammetry were used to analyzed the frontier molecular orbital of the two compounds. The result suggest that compound 2 can used not only as dopants but also as host emission and electron injection materials. Two kinds of red OLEDs were fabricated using 2 and all the devices achieved good CIE coordinates.
